التحقق من المدخلات
يوجد
طريقتين للتحقق من المدخلات :
- التحقق من صيغة مدخلات الحقل
في صيغ التحقق من مدخلات الحقول ، لا يمكن أن
تشير الى حقل أو عمود آخر
إعداد صيغة الحقل المدخل ،،، من خصائص الحقل
نفسه
- التحقق من مدخلات القائمة
في صيغ التحقق من مدخلات القائمة ، يمكن أن
تشير الى حقل آخر في نفس السجل
إعداد صيغة مدخلات القائمة
،،، من إعدادات القائمة ---<
إعدادات التحقق من الصحة
الصيغ المستخدمة للتحقق من المدخلات :
- OR
- AND
- LEN (Length)
- Pattern Maching Using Search and Find
- Date Testing
ملاحظات
:
- الصيغة يجب أن ترجع القيمة True
- التحقق من صيغة مدخلات الحقول يمكن إضافتها في أنواع الحقول التالية ( نص مفرد ، رقم ، قائمة إختيار ، عملة ، تاريخ ووقت )
- التعبيرات أو الصيغ المستخدمة تشابة نوعاً ما صيغ ومعادلات الإكسل ، لكن ليس كل دوال الإكسل
- الحقول المسماة بدون رموز خاصة ممكن أن تضمنها في أقواس مربعه أو بدون
مثال :
Price * [Qty] > 100
Price * [Qty] > 100
- الحقول المسماة بمسافات او رموز خاصة يجب أن تكون ضمن أقواس مربعة معلقة
مثال :
OR ([Sale Region]=1,[Sale Region]=1)
- النصوص المستخدمة للمقارنة ليست حساسة لحالة الأحرف
مثال :
OR(Status="a",Status="D")
صيغ
التحقق من مدخلات الحقل تاريخ ووقت :
انظر المثال التالي :
- التاريخ المدخل في المستقبل > Today()إسم الحقل
- التاريخ المدخل أكبر من اليوم بـ 3 أيام > Today() +3إسم الحقل
- التاريخ يجب أن يكون ما بين اليوم وتاريخ نهاية السنة الحالية
- التاريخ المدخل يجب أن يكون يوم أحد
- التاريخ المدخل يجب أن يكون آخر يوم من الشهر
- التاريخ المدخل يحب أن يكون أول
يوم من الشهر
خدعة :
نعرف أن الحقل من نص متعدد لا يقبل عمل علية
صيغة تحقق من مدخلات الحقل
يمكن ذلك عبر الخدعة التالية :
يمكن ذلك عبر الخدعة التالية :
انشاء الحقل بالبداية من نوع نص مفرد ، ثم
تطبيق الصيغة علية ، ثم نعود لخصائص الحقل ونغير نوع الحقل الى نص متعدد
تعليقات
إرسال تعليق